Javascript McCustomsCrollBar:未捕获类型错误:$(…)。McCustomsCrollBar不是调整窗口大小的函数
我正试图根据窗口的宽度初始化并销毁一个mCustomScrollBar滚动条插件(es6应用程序中的一些jquery,使用webpack/babel进行传输)。但是,调整窗口大小时出现错误: “未捕获的TypeError:$(…).McCustomsCrollBar不是函数” 这是我的密码:Javascript McCustomsCrollBar:未捕获类型错误:$(…)。McCustomsCrollBar不是调整窗口大小的函数,javascript,jquery,jquery-plugins,ecmascript-6,Javascript,Jquery,Jquery Plugins,Ecmascript 6,我正试图根据窗口的宽度初始化并销毁一个mCustomScrollBar滚动条插件(es6应用程序中的一些jquery,使用webpack/babel进行传输)。但是,调整窗口大小时出现错误: “未捕获的TypeError:$(…).McCustomsCrollBar不是函数” 这是我的密码: function initCustomScrollbar() { var scrollPane = document.querySelector(".scroll-content"); va
function initCustomScrollbar() {
var scrollPane = document.querySelector(".scroll-content");
var scrollPaneInit = $(scrollPane).mCustomScrollbar();
setTimeout(function () {
var scrollInnerPane = $(scrollPane).find(".mCustomScrollBox");
$(scrollInnerPane).height(window.innerHeight + "px");
}, 500);
$(window).resize(function () {
if (window.innerWidth < 768) {
initCustomScrollbar();
} else {
$(scrollPane).mCustomScrollBar('destroy');
}
});
}
initCustomScrollbar();
函数initCustomScrollbar(){
var scrollPane=document.querySelector(“滚动内容”);
var scrollPaneInit=$(scrollPane.mCustomScrollbar();
setTimeout(函数(){
var scrollInnerPane=$(scrollPane.find(“.mCustomScrollBox”);
$(scrollInnerPane).height(window.innerHeight+“px”);
}, 500);
$(窗口)。调整大小(函数(){
如果(窗内宽度<768){
initCustomScrollbar();
}否则{
$(滚动窗格).mCustomScrollBar('destroy');
}
});
}
initCustomScrollbar();
有人能指出我哪里出了问题吗?我已经解决了这个问题,不知何故我的潜意识忘记了Javascript是区分大小写的。。。该函数应为:
$(scrollPane).mCustomScrollbar();
不是
嗯 也许你没有加载插件。它肯定在加载,除非我会收到404错误…如果你忘记包含插件,它肯定在加载。当我查看源代码并单击链接时,它加载缩小的脚本。
$(scrollPane).mCustomScrollBar();